In memory of

Stephen McMillan

September 14, 1963 -  February 11, 2017

Stephen passed suddenly at 12:32 pm that Saturday, he suffered of a massive heart attack in his driveway of his home that he loved with all his heart. Steven passed with a good friend Kyle by his side and on the property he so proudly owned and loved. We the family will be forever indebted to this fine young man for all that he has done for Stephen before, during and then for us after his passing.

Stephen was one of the most down to earth people one could ever hope to meet. Loyal brother and friend to all he met in his travels.

Stephen is the beloved son of Thomas James McMillan (1936-2015) and mother Mary June (McMurray)McMillan, he was very proud to have been born in Belfast, Northern Ireland just as his father Thomas and mother June were father. While his passing will reunite him with his father he is already heart brokenly missed by his dear mother.

He also leaves behind 3 siblings James Edmund McMillan, 57, Sandra McMillan, 55 and Lorraine (Spencer) McMillan, 51, and was a most wonderful brother to have had.

He will be dearly missed by his many nephews and nieces and especially by niece Jay-Cee Simpson and nephews Scott Simpson and Hogan McMillan with whom he held an extra special bond with.

While Stephen didn't have any children of his own by birth, he will be dearly missed by two very special step daughters who entered his life. Elise and Micheline Hawley of Uxbridge, Ontario who came to love him just as much as much we did and we love them as he did.
